SPT02-236DDB
Automation sensor transient and overvoltage protection
µQFN-2L
SPT02-236DDB
Features
• Double diode array for switch protection and
reverse blocking protection
• 6 V to 36 V supply voltage range
• Minimum breakdown voltage VBR: 38 V
• 8/20 µs 2 A maximum clamping voltage: 46 V
• Blocking diode drop forward voltage VF:
1.1 V at 300 mA
• Blocking diode maximum 10 ms square pulse
current IFSM: 3 A
• Ambient temperature: -40 °C to +100 °C
• µQFN 2L 0.8 mm flat package
Complies with following standards
• Voltage surge: IEC 61000-4-5, RCC = 500 Ω,
±1 kV
• Electrostatic discharge, IEC 61000-4-2:
– ±8 kV contact discharge
– ±15 kV air discharge
• Electrical transient immunity: IEC 61000-4-4:
±2 kV
Benefits
• Compliant for interface with logic input type 1,
2 and 3 IEC 61131-2 standard
• Highly compact with integrated power solution
in SMD version

Applications
• Factory automation sensor application
• Proximity sensor interface protection
• Transient and surge voltage protection
• Compliant with sensor standard, EN 60947-5-2
Description
The SPT02 is specifically designed for the
protection of 24 V proximity sensors. It
implements the reverse polarity and the
overvoltage protection of the sensor power supply
and the power switch overvoltage protection.
It provides a very compact and flexible solution.
Thanks to high performance ST technology, the
SPT02 protects the proximity sensor to the
highest level compliant with IEC 61000-4-2, IEC
61000-4-4 and IEC 61000-4-5 standards.
